Output 99fdbf875a324975c63b05ab7de33438373ef6993ef2cc117dfddac50d652fa4:14

value
141799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f20a493a4a8e4f6847cac5ae8e1b6c12189df7a OP_EQUAL
address
3GCQU7S2pH5QESdgD3KFJ1GcypLksBFLYK
transaction
99fdbf875a324975c63b05ab7de33438373ef6993ef2cc117dfddac50d652fa4
confirmations
17017
spent
true